Transaction 07d8dc2564fa3d7ab25fdb1d6004adc268df72c35942de461e0ff2ebb70739f2

3 Input
2 Outputs
  • 07d8dc2564fa3d7ab25fdb1d6004adc268df72c35942de461e0ff2ebb70739f2:0
  • value  12076326
    address  1PcTHhk8f7bSjeDSvxUyWkguuMYVZhTUyu
  • 07d8dc2564fa3d7ab25fdb1d6004adc268df72c35942de461e0ff2ebb70739f2:1
  • value  4850559
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c